What Are Your Certifications and Credentials?



When evaluating a financial advisor, what certifications and credentials should one try to find? Prospective customers need to prioritize qualifications such as Qualified Monetary Planner (CFP), Chartered Financial Expert (CFA), or Personal Financial Expert (PFS) These designations indicate an extensive understanding of financial planning and financial investment management. Furthermore, validating the advisor's academic history, such as degrees in money or economics, can provide understanding right into their proficiency. It is additionally important to analyze their regulative background with sources like the Financial Industry Regulatory Authority (FINRA) or the Stocks and Exchange Commission (SEC) This guarantees there are no significant disciplinary activities or issues. Ultimately, a qualified advisor must possess both the needed credentials and a tidy regulatory document, fostering trust fund and self-confidence in their expert capacities.

Fee Structures Explained Clearly



What approaches do economic advisors utilize to charge for their solutions? Financial advisors normally utilize various cost structures to make up for their know-how. The most common methods consist of per hour fees, flat fees, and asset-based fees. Hourly fees bill clients for the time invested on economic preparation and recommendations, while level costs give an established cost for specific solutions or projects. Asset-based charges are calculated as a percent of the client's investment profile, lining up the advisor's profits with the client's financial efficiency. Additionally, some advisors might offer retainer costs, which call for customers to pay a repeating fee for recurring services. Understanding these frameworks is important for clients to assess expenses and establish which model lines up finest with their monetary requirements and objectives.


Payment vs. Fee-Only



When thinking about the very best method to make up a financial advisor, clients typically locate themselves weighing the distinctions between commission-based and fee-only structures. Commission-based advisors gain a percent of the products they market, which might create potential disputes of passion, as their income can depend on clients buying certain financial investments. In comparison, fee-only advisors charge a level cost or a percentage of possessions under administration, straightening their interests more very closely with those of their customers. This framework advertises transparency, as clients pay directly for the advisor's know-how as opposed to for details economic items. Understanding these differences can aid clients pick an expert whose payment model straightens with their economic goals and guarantees they receive unbiased recommendations customized to their requirements.


Hidden Expenses to Consider



How do hidden prices influence the total value of financial advisory solutions? Financial advisors might charge fees in numerous methods, consisting of hourly rates, flat costs, or a percent of properties under monitoring. Customers need to likewise take into consideration possible surprise prices that can reduce the value obtained. These may include trading charges, fund expenditure ratios, or commissions linked to certain investment items. Such service charges can erode financial investment returns over time. Openness is important; subsequently, clients need to ask about all possible costs connected with the advisor's solutions. Comprehending the full fee structure makes it possible for clients to make enlightened decisions, making certain that they choose a consultant that straightens with their economic goals while decreasing unforeseen expenditures.
